Surviving Aliens and an Ice Age
Devin moved to a small island town in Alaska for a fresh start. Now, his quiet life has turned into a fight for survival against plunging temperatures and an extraterrestrial invasion.
With hostile aliens and failing technology, he must quickly learn to harness the nanotechnology he now controls to build settlements and save his adoptive hometown from the new threats.
On a timer and facing dropping temperatures and morale, Devin must gather allies, master his control over the new technology, and create nano-powered settlements that can survive the looming ice age. With humanity’s very existence at stake, he’s learning to balance competing priorities while saving as many people as possible.
The stakes are high, and he must fight, level, and build to keep his corner of southeast Alaska alive in the first book of this city-building GameLit survival series.

The base building is fantastic as Devin struggles to save as many lives as he can before the coming ice age. Now, with the new perks Devin has received, I'm excited to find out what new options he will have going forward.
I wasn't familiar with Brad Derry, but he did a fantastic job narrating the story and has a good range of voices to separate characters and let you relax into the story.
This book really sets itself apart from other base-building novels, as it focuses on modern day Earth in a scarily possible future. (Probably not the aliens, but eventual climate change.)
Highly Recommended!! A solid 15/15, and I can't wait for the next one!
